How How Long Does a Hemorrhoid Last Actually Works
To grasp the concept of how long a hemorrhoid lasts, it's essential to first understand what hemorrhoids are. These swollen veins in the rectum or anus can arise from various factors, including diet, genetics, and lifestyle. Typically, hemorrhoids are categorized into internal and external types, with the former more common in the US. Duration-wise, internal hemorrhoids may last anywhere from a few days to several weeks if left untreated. External hemorrhoids, on the other hand, can cause discomfort for a shorter time, usually resolving on their own within a week.

Things People Often Misunderstand
Myth: Hemorrhoids are a sign of poor personal hygiene.
Reality: While cleanliness is essential for overall health, hemorrhoids have varying causes and can develop based on factors such as pregnancy, pregnancy-related weight gain, and bowel-straining activities.
Myth: A shorter duration for external hemorrhoids means safer outcomes.
Reality: While external hemorrhoids may disappear quickly, ignoring internal hemorrhoids or failing to treat underlying conditions can lead to complications.
